The course is designed to enable you to communicate with Deaf people in British Sign Language at level 1 standard within a range of everyday topics. The course leads to the Level 1 Award in BSL, accredited by the Signature awarding body. The qualification comprises three units: introduction to British Sign Language, conversational British Sign Language and British Sign Language at school, college or work. You will have the opportunity to undertake the examinations for these three units within the course.
To achieve the full certificate in BSL, you must pass all three units. Unit BSL101 is internally assessed. Units BSL102 and BSL103 are externally assessed by a Signature assessor.
What will we cover?
You will learn level 1 BSL communication skills relating to the following topic areas:
- meeting people
- using numbers
- weather
- transport
- directions
- people, animals and objects in the home
- interests and activities
- food and drink
- getting around.
What will I achieve? By the end of this course you should be able to...
- understand and use a limited range of simple words and sentences in BSL
- take part in simple conversations in BSL
- give and understand simple directions in BSL
- give and understand simple descriptions in BSL.

Carolina comes from a deaf family and has always used Sign Language. Her Level 3 teaching qualification enables Carolina to teach BSL classes. Carolina teaches introduction to BSL and level 1 at City Lit. When not working at City Lit, she also works at Oak Lodge school as a Teaching Assistant with deaf pupils from year 7 to year 11 and as a BSL teacher with hearing parents of deaf children. Outside of work she is actively involved in the deaf community around the UK - volunteering as liaison women's coordinator for the Deaf champion football league of Europe, deaf youth club and is an active member of a deaf badminton group.
